How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Marietta?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Southeast Marietta Studio Apartments | $1,840 | $959 | $6,616 |
Southeast Marietta 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,619 | $777 | $6,094 |
Southeast Marietta 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,982 | $1,009 | $7,085 |
Southeast Marietta 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,504 | $1,250 | $8,861 |
Southeast Marietta 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,418 | $1,199 | $3,598 |
